Oracle数据库驱动与移动应用开发:打造高效移动数据库解决方案,满足移动应用需求
发布时间: 2024-07-25 06:39:01 阅读量: 31 订阅数: 30
![Oracle数据库驱动与移动应用开发:打造高效移动数据库解决方案,满足移动应用需求](https://img-blog.csdnimg.cn/a88e11c21490420ca27b9e9e76fc4671.png)
# 1. Oracle数据库驱动简介
Oracle数据库驱动是用于在移动应用程序中连接和操作Oracle数据库的软件组件。它充当应用程序和数据库之间的桥梁,允许应用程序执行SQL语句、检索数据并修改数据库。
Oracle数据库驱动具有以下优势:
- **高性能:**Oracle数据库驱动经过优化,可在移动设备上提供快速、高效的数据库访问。
- **可靠性:**Oracle数据库驱动经过严格测试,以确保在各种网络条件下稳定可靠。
- **安全性:**Oracle数据库驱动提供安全功能,例如加密和身份验证,以保护数据免遭未经授权的访问。
# 2. Oracle数据库驱动与移动应用开发
### 2.1 移动应用开发对数据库的需求
随着移动设备的普及和移动互联网的发展,移动应用开发已成为软件开发领域的重要组成部分。移动应用开发对数据库的需求主要体现在以下几个方面:
- **数据存储:**移动应用需要存储用户数据、应用数据和配置信息,以提供个性化和交互式体验。
- **数据查询:**移动应用需要查询数据库以获取数据,例如用户资料、订单信息和产品列表。
- **数据更新:**移动应用需要更新数据库以修改数据,例如更新用户地址、添加新订单或删除产品。
- **数据同步:**移动应用需要与服务器同步数据,以保持数据的一致性和实时性。
### 2.2 Oracle数据库驱动的优势和特点
Oracle数据库驱动是Oracle公司提供的用于连接Oracle数据库的软件组件。它具有以下优势和特点:
- **稳定可靠:**Oracle数据库驱动经过严格测试,确保在各种移动设备和操作系统上稳定运行。
- **高性能:**Oracle数据库驱动采用优化算法,最大限度地提高数据库访问速度和数据传输效率。
- **安全可靠:**Oracle数据库驱动支持多种安全协议,例如SSL和TLS,以保护数据传输安全。
- **跨平台支持:**Oracle数据库驱动支持多种移动平台,包括Android、iOS、Windows Phone和BlackBerry。
- **易于使用:**Oracle数据库驱动提供了易于使用的API,简化了移动应用与Oracle数据库的交互。
### 2.3 Oracle数据库驱动的安装和配置
Oracle数据库驱动的安装和配置因移动平台而异。以下介绍在Android和iOS平台上的安装和配置步骤:
#### Android平台
1. 在Android Studio中添加Oracle数据库驱动依赖项:
```xml
dependencies {
implementation 'com.oracle.database.jdbc:ojdbc8:21.3.0.0'
}
```
2. 配置AndroidManifest.xml文件,添加网络权限:
```xml
<uses-permission android:name="android.permission.INTERNET" />
```
#### i
0
0